diff options
author | Felix Fietkau <nbd@nbd.name> | 2021-02-14 19:55:09 +0100 |
---|---|---|
committer | Felix Fietkau <nbd@nbd.name> | 2021-02-14 19:55:45 +0100 |
commit | f118be07126e88f2fd393909675d815e0b0fd315 (patch) | |
tree | 569f72ee93dfe615de03ad8abbe9f60a2ba7f130 /.github/pull_request_template | |
parent | bc3963764d5a3bc2371a890dbe76d3b6dc131d10 (diff) | |
download | upstream-f118be07126e88f2fd393909675d815e0b0fd315.tar.gz upstream-f118be07126e88f2fd393909675d815e0b0fd315.tar.bz2 upstream-f118be07126e88f2fd393909675d815e0b0fd315.zip |
ath9k: fix transmitting to stations in dynamic SMPS mode
When transmitting to a receiver in dynamic SMPS mode, all transmissions that
use multiple spatial streams need to be sent using CTS-to-self or RTS/CTS to
give the receiver's extra chains some time to wake up.
This fixes the tx rate getting stuck at <= MCS7 for some clients, especially
Intel ones, which make aggressive use of SMPS.
Signed-off-by: Felix Fietkau <nbd@nbd.name>
Diffstat (limited to '.github/pull_request_template')
0 files changed, 0 insertions, 0 deletions